    Inauguration Tickets

    As most know, Inguration Tickets are free, you can get 1 on a first come 1stserve Bases from you Senator, Congress Perosn ect
    They are workingon a Bill in Congress that has the Support of BOTH Parties, that would make seling these tickets a Federal Offense since they are FREE to the Public
    Do you Agree with this, that ther should be a Law Prohibiting the Sales of these tickets
    Keep in mind almost ALL if Not ALL Republicans and Denocrats agree with this Pending Bill

    Ebay and other sites have already told the Pubic they will not allow them to be sold on their Web Sites
